Output 16561de4143243731a816161061d8cae19341cf94fa0ece8bf903ed41ff78433:8

value
29244774
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4ba39cb1bf4125982b7d81112b23c9ff2da5b14 OP_EQUALVERIFY OP_CHECKSIG
address
1MrQ9vvPXvWCo1LNCphd26X3YnATsMvfg2
transaction
16561de4143243731a816161061d8cae19341cf94fa0ece8bf903ed41ff78433
spent
true